Caledonia County Fair Mountain View Park in Lyndonville Aug. 22-26

The Caledonia County Fair returns to Mountain View Park in Lyndonville Aug. 22-26 with a full schedule of family-friendly entertainment and agriculture events.

Creating family fun since 1855, Vermont's oldest fair features midway rides for all ages, live music, Pirates of the Colombian Caribbean aerial-high wire thrill show, demolition derbies, livestock exhibits and shows, pulling contests, Fire Show, Punch and Judy Puppet Show, Children's Tent activities, exhibits, chainsaw carving, bingo, carnival games, favorite fair food and more.
